What is the genre of the story ?
Science fiction
15
Is that in the past or in the future?
Future
15
What happened on May 17, 2155?
Tommy found a real book
15
In “The Fun They Had,” what does the old book help Tommy and Margie learn about the past?
how children were taught
15
Why does the County Inspector come to Margie’s home?
to repair the machine that teaches Margie
15
Tommy is busy reading the book, what does this suggest about his attitude toward the book?
He thinks the book is interesting
15
What does Tommy say the book is about?
school
15
What did Margie´s grandfather tell her?
All the stories just to be printed
15
What is Margie´s reaction to learning that teachers used to be people?
She is surprised. She thinks people are not as smart as mechanical teachers.
15
How does Margie’s changing point of view help to develop the story’s theme?
She has become more interested in learning about life in the past.
15
Where did Margie go after reading the book with Tommy?
She went into the schoolroom.
15
Margie should be thinking about her lessons on fractions, what was she actually thinking?
She was thinking about how school used to be fun.
